Not too bad. shalloWMeans (129), Florence, Kentucky, USA Sep 1, 2008 A real heavy seas experience, this imperial (or uber, as Clipper City calls it) pilsner comes on with waves of leafy, floral hops, in a sea of hazy, bright sunny gold. The aroma is vague, yet has fresh, citrussy pineapple notes, lemon drop candy, and a backbone of bready malt. The mouthfeel is wonderfully crisp and spicy, and refreshes with further notes of tropical fruits, more pineapple, paprika and lemon-pepper, and has a very appealing, drying hop finish that leaves bright lemony notes lingering on the tongue for quite some time. The hops in this beer are very well integrated in the balance, and just seem to flow smoothly without too much intensity. A nice lager indeed- refreshing yet complex, from one of America’s most underrated micros.
